Review Your Lock Types Options
The first step in selecting the right lock is to understand the different types available. Modern door locks generally fall into three categories: mechanical, mechanical keyless, and electronic. Each category offers unique benefits and considerations, making it important to assess your needs carefully.
Mechanical Locks
Mechanical locks are the traditional security choice, offering reliability and affordability. These locks do not require electricity and have been used for thousands of years to secure homes. Common types of mechanical locks include:
- Mortise lock
- Cylinder lock
- Spring bolt
- Deadbolt
One of the reasons mechanical locks are still widely recommended by residential locksmiths is their durability. These locks, particularly those with multipoint systems, are known for being strong and secure. They are also weather-resistant, making them ideal for homes in various climates. Additionally, mechanical locks are simple to operate and don’t require batteries or electrical power.
However, the downside is that mechanical locks lack the advanced features offered by electronic locks. Keys can be easily lost or stolen, and the lock may need rekeying or replacement more frequently.
Mechanical Keyless Locks
If you want to reduce the risks of lost or stolen keys, mechanical keyless locks may be a great option. These locks feature a push-button mechanism that uses a programmable code to unlock the door, providing a keyless entry solution. Some models even allow for a key override as an optional feature.
The benefits of mechanical keyless locks include enhanced security since there are no physical keys involved. Additionally, you won’t need to worry about frequent rekeying, making them both practical and cost-effective.
Electronic Locks
For homeowners looking for convenience and advanced security, electronic locks provide an excellent solution. These modern locks offer keyless entry and can even be controlled remotely, often integrating with home security systems and cameras. Types of electronic locks include:
- Keypad door locks
- Smartphone-operated locks
- Biometric locks
- Key fob/key card locks
While electronic locks offer enhanced convenience, they can be more expensive than mechanical locks and require regular battery changes. Additionally, power outages could leave you unable to access your home if there is no backup power supply.
Other Lock Considerations
When choosing a lock, it’s important to consider your door’s material. Metal or vintage doors may require special drilling, so consulting a professional locksmith in Los Angeles is recommended. Also, always check that the locks you’re considering meet current safety regulations. Opting for Grade 1 or Grade 2 locks ensures high-level security for your home.
